3 youths held on charge of subversive activities in Habiganj

Police arrested three young men in connection with subversive activities from Umednagar area in Sadar upazila early Monday.
The arrested were identified as Faisal Miah, 18, son of Majibur Rahman, a resident of Kalipur village in Sadar upazila of Bhairab district; Sajjad alias Sadat, 25, son of Kadar Ali and Rahmat Ali, son of Nimbar Ali, both residents of Umednagar village in Sadar upazila of Habiganj district.Tipped off, a team of police conducted a drive in the area and arrested the trio in the dead of night, said Najim Uddin, officer-in-charge of Sadar Police Station.During interrogation, Faisal reportedly confessed they had hurled two crude bombs at the residence of the district’s additional superintendent of police Shahidul Islam.He reportedly admitted that he had bought some plastic bottles and 10 litres of petrol on Sadat’s order.Three crude bombs were also hurled at the residences of assistant superintendents of police Sazzadul Hasan, Sazzat Ibn Roy and Masudur Rahman Monir in the district on January 23. -UNB, Habiganj
